Executive Summary

Immunic, Inc. (IMUX) trades around $11.55, just above the computed support of $8.50 and well below the resistance of $13.30. The 20‑day SMA ($11.04) sits just under the current price, while the 50‑day SMA ($11.33) is slightly higher, indicating a modest neutral trend. Technical momentum is mildly bullish, with the MACD line above its signal (histogram +0.07) and an RSI of 52, suggesting neither overbought nor oversold conditions. However, the 30‑day volatility is extremely high at roughly 93% and beta is 1.38, flagging pronounced price swings and market sensitivity. Fundamentally, the company has no revenue and is burning cash at a steep rate, reflected by negative EBITDA of $109.5 M and free cash flow deficits of $43.5 M, though it holds $186.6 M in cash against minimal debt. The forward PE is –3.2 and price‑to‑book is –20.8, underscoring the lack of earnings and negative book value. Recent material news includes a Europe‑wide patent granted for its lead asset, a 1‑for‑10 reverse stock split, and the appointment of a seasoned CMO and board chair ahead of a pivotal multiple‑sclerosis trial readout. The Fear & Greed Index labels market sentiment as “Extreme Greed,” which may be inflating short‑term demand. Overall, the stock sits at a crossroads of high technical volatility, a cash runway that could fund upcoming trials, and significant regulatory and execution risk.
